Living Against Your Own Biology
Our bodies are designed to be awake during the day and asleep at night. But shift workers don’t have that luxury. Their schedules are flipped, rotated, or completely unpredictable—and the toll is physical, emotional, and mental.

SWSD symptoms include:

Chronic fatigue

Poor concentration

Irritability and mood swings

Insomnia or restless sleep during the day

Increased risk of anxiety, depression, and long-term health issues

For many, this isn’t just a phase—it’s their reality, every day.
